Candles have different melting points, and tapers tend to melt much hotter than paraffin candles (so they last longer and don't drip all over the tablecloth). Go to the craft store and buy some plain paraffin candles, and try those. I've found that melted paraffin is warm, but not so warm that you can't dunk your finger in the melted wax with no ill effects.

Also, have him pour the wax from 3-4 or more feet above (or away from) your body so it can cool even more on it's way down.

Lastly, have him start on thicker skin, like the palm of your hand or your knee, to get you used to the heat, then move on to more sensitive areas, like your chest or back of your thighs if you can tolerate the heat.

Go slowly, and use the right tools, and you should be able to do this. If not, don't worry- your level of kink won't be determined by whether or not you can tolerate candle wx!
